Output 8674e524849bedd44631e3321aedc95527f54366e5b89b32faef1a9e55bd2120:0

value
1453584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 804a970300189a4bccddcdfb25d3265cbc1397ee OP_EQUAL
address
3DPMmhEK8hm7hnoeGkN7BAzPJMqy7ecu4Q
transaction
8674e524849bedd44631e3321aedc95527f54366e5b89b32faef1a9e55bd2120
spent
true